HVBattle

HVBattle provides reusable HentaiVerse battle-domain APIs. It builds on hvbrowser for the authenticated Hentaiverse browser session and keeps the private command-line runner in a separate application workspace.

The package exposes a policy-neutral BattleSession, atomic battle actions, and a BattleRunner that runs exactly one already-active battle using a client-supplied BattleStrategy. It never repairs equipment, recovers stamina, or starts Arena/GrindFest on its own. Campaign policy and post-battle work belong to the calling application.

BattleSession preloads the PonyChart classifier and ONNX model before opening the browser, so a timed challenge never pays the first-load cost. The runner checks for and resolves PonyChart before parsing an ordinary battle turn or calling client strategy code.

import asyncio

from hvbattle import BattleCompleted, BattleRunner, BattleSession, TurnDecision


class MyStrategy:
    async def take_turn(self, session: BattleSession, /) -> TurnDecision:
        if await session.go_next_floor():
            return TurnDecision.ACTED
        if not session.alive_monster_ids:
            return TurnDecision.IDLE
        if await session.attack_monster(session.alive_monster_ids[0]):
            return TurnDecision.ACTED
        return TurnDecision.IDLE


async def after_battle(session: BattleSession, completed: BattleCompleted) -> None:
    print(completed)


async def main() -> None:
    async with BattleSession(headless=True) as session:
        result = await BattleRunner(session, MyStrategy()).run_current()
        if isinstance(result, BattleCompleted):
            await after_battle(session, result)


asyncio.run(main())

The example requires credentials through the normal EH_USERNAME and EH_PASSWORD indirection and an already-active server battle; otherwise run_current() returns None. TurnDecision.STOP deliberately returns a BattleStopped result. Leaving the battle page without positive final-round completion evidence raises BattleInterruptedError, so callers cannot mistake an expired login or unexpected navigation for a completed battle.

BattleDriver is only a transitional name alias for BattleSession, not an API-compatible implementation of the old driver. Migrate constructor strategy settings into a BattleStrategy, replace driver.battle() with BattleRunner(driver, strategy).run_current(), and perform maintenance, post-battle tasks, and next-battle selection after the returned BattleCompleted. Arena choice follows the same boundary: list_arena_options() returns data and start_arena(option) starts only the option explicitly selected by the caller. GrindFest uses the equivalent list_grindfest_options() and start_grindfest(option) pair; the package does not silently choose the first or last server option.

BaseControlPanel, ControlPanel, and NullControlPanel provide reusable pause, named-action, named-toggle, and validated integer mechanisms. The set_actions() API is the generic spelling; the older set_skills() spelling remains available as a compatibility alias. Integer edits become live only after Apply or Enter, so partially typed mutation amounts are never published. Closing the interactive window sets the pause flag before the GUI exits.

The package does not register campaign choices or choose their defaults: a calling application owns the control names, labels, initial values, and the policy that reads their committed state. Importing hvbattle does not import Tk or start a GUI process.

Development

Build a clean environment backed by PyPI releases:

bash scripts/rebuild-env.sh

For coordinated local development before all dependent releases are on PyPI, overlay editable checkouts in dependency order:
